Sort By
2019 BMW X4
xDrive M40d 5dr Step Auto
xDrive M40d 5dr Step Auto
JCT600 Approved Centre Bradford - 90 miles away
59,236 miles
Request callback
£28,500
2020 BMW X4
xDrive M40d 5dr Step Auto
xDrive M40d 5dr Step Auto
Marshall Volkswagen Scunthorpe - 93 miles away
32,033 miles
Request callback
£32,785
2021 BMW X4
Diesel Estate M40d M40d
Diesel Estate M40d M40d
Prestige Cars Kent - 116 miles away
64,652 miles
Request callback
£31,355
2022 BMW X4
Diesel Estate M40d M40d
Diesel Estate M40d M40d
Prestige Cars Kent - 116 miles away
28,845 miles
Request callback
£42,054
2019 BMW X4
xDrive M40d 5dr Step Auto
xDrive M40d 5dr Step Auto
Group 1 Norwich BMW - 128 miles away
66,500 miles
Request callback
£29,410
Buy new from | £28,932 | (list price from £32,290) |
Showing 1 - 5 of 5 cars